SONES (as SNSD Girls’ Generation‘s fans are lovingly known), you best prepare yourselves for an upcoming episode of Oh!K’s “Warm and Cozy”.
Seohyun of SNSD is confirmed to be making a special cameo appearance in the 13th episode of the Korean leading primetime drama, which will premiere next Thursday (16th July) at 8:55pm on Oh!K (Astro Ch. 394), Malaysia’s hottest Korean entertainment channel.
Seohyun will play the matchmaker niece of Hwang Ok (played by Kim Sung Oh), who tries to bring her bachelor uncle and Lee Jeong-ju (played by Kang So-ra) together. In that particular episode, Poongsan (played by Jinyoung of B1A4), swoons over Hwang Ok’s niece’s effortless beauty and charm, manages to convince her to have a 2nd round of drinks at the “Warm and Cozy” restaurant.
According to Soompi, Seohyun filmed for her cameo on 21st June at Jeju Island. Her presence is said to have filled the film set with energy, as the male staff members tried to get a closer look at her in person.
Regarding her cameo, Seohyun said:
I watched “Warm and Cozy” without missing a single episode because it is a production of the director and scriptwriter I have always liked, so I was very happy to be able to appear in it. I was able to focus well due to all of the actors and staff members’ warmth and kindness. It’s disappointing that it was so short, but I think it will remain as a good memory for me.
Written by the Hong Sisters, “Warm and Cozy” is a romantic comedy drama series from MBC which comes with twist on the fable of “The Ant and the Grasshopper”.
It stars Yoo Yeon-seok as Baek Geon-wu and Kang So-ra as Lee Jeong-ju, and other celebrity appearances include famed TV actor So Ji Sub.
The official plot summary is as follows:
Having failed in her career and love life, Jeong-ju decides to move to Jeju where she meets Geon-wu, a chef and restaurant owner, but also a hopeless romantic. With such different personalities, the series explores whether this mismatched couple can find true love on this beautiful island.
“Warm and Cozy”, which airs every Thursday and Friday at 8:55pm on Oh!K, is available in English, Chinese, and Bahasa Malaysia subtitles.
